Java Fullstack

Singapore 11 days agoFull-time External
Negotiable
Basic Qualifications - Experience: 4–5 years of Full Stack Java Development in a containerized microservices architecture using Java/Spring Boot, with strong UI/UX development experience in React. - Microservices & Cloud: Hands-on experience with Kubernetes and AWS. Backend Development: - Java EE Framework: Spring Boot - ORM Framework: Hibernate - Database: MySQL and/or MongoDB (Open Source) - Application Server: Spring Boot - Web Server: JBOSS Web Server Frontend Development: - React 18+ - HTML5/CSS (knowledge of web page design is a plus) Development Tools & Platforms: - IDEs: VS Code, IntelliJ - Repository: GitHub - Issue Tracking: JIRA - CI/CD: Jenkins Additional Skills: Strong knowledge of open-source web development tools and modern software engineering practices. Our engineers do more than just write code: - You'll help our customers achieve their real goals by understanding their requirements and how they respond to their business needs. - You'll use technologies that include Java 17 and above, Microservices, MySQL, Spring Boot v5.0, React 18 and above. - You will analyse business requirements and architect a solution that is robust and scalable along with providing technical documentation of solution. - You'll leverage on new technologies to build the next generation of Payments ecosystem services - You'll develop and deliver new features every few weeks and be responsible for them end-end - You have the work and academic experience that will demonstrate proficiency and ease with programming languages, code quality initiatives, scripting languages and operating systems - You have excellent communication and interpersonal skills and above all, you are a team player